Pendleton, The Portland Collection : Americana Heritage

Pendleton has always been a company known for their rich heritage and beautiful Native American fabrics. The region is reflected in their southwestern American style clothing.  Recently the brand debuted a new fall 2011 line, Pendleton, the Portland Collection, which opens up a new target market for the brand in younger consumers.  The brand hired two up-and-coming designers for the new line, Nathaniel Crissman and Rachel Turk, creators of Church & State.  Also part of the collaboration is John Blasioli, the stylist behind indie legends, The Decemberists.  All of which are Portland grown artists.  The collection will include Navajo inspired prints and buffalo plaids.
